Warning Signs You Need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al

Ignoring the signs of a leak can cost you dearly in the long run. Don’t wait until it’s too late, identify the warning signs and act quickly.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

When you notice a persistent musty smell in your kitchen or refrigerator, it’s a clear indication that there’s a leak somewhere. Don’t ignore it, address the issue right away. Our technicians can help you track down the source of the smell and fix the leak before it causes more damage.

How Do I Prevent Refrigerator Water Line Leaks?

To prevent Refrigerator Water Line Leaks, make sure to:

  • Regularly inspect your refrigerator’s water line for signs of damage or wear.
  • Check your water pressure to ensure it’s within the manufacturer’s recommended range.
  • Replace worn or damaged water lines quickly.
  • Focus on regular maintenance to prevent leaks and ensure your refrigerator is working efficiently.
